老照片免费修复教程(火棍PS)

火棍PS是一款免费且功能强大的图片编辑类App,专注于提供老照片修复、图片压缩转码、尺寸调整、一键抠图和拼图等实用功能。无论您是想要复原珍贵的旧照片,还是需要快速调整照片尺寸,这款App都能帮您轻松实现。本教程将带您逐步了解火棍PS的主要功能及其使用方法。


1. 老照片修复:让回忆清晰如新

老照片往往是承载着情感的宝贵记忆。火棍PS提供的老照片修复功能,能够帮助您修复泛黄、划痕、褪色等问题,让照片恢复原有的色彩和清晰度。

操作步骤:

  1. 打开火棍PS并选择“老照片修复”功能。
  2. 从相册中选择您需要修复的老照片。
  3. 系统将自动检测照片中的缺陷,并自动修复破损区域,包括划痕和模糊的部分。
  4. 修复完成后,您可以预览效果。如果需要进一步微调,可以使用提供的调整工具来调整对比度、亮度等参数。
  5. 点击“保存”即可将修复后的照片保存在相册中。

小提示: 可以使用增强滤镜进一步美化修复后的照片,让效果更加自然。


2. 照片压缩与格式转换:优化文件大小,轻松分享

在照片分享过程中,文件大小和格式兼容性经常会成为问题。火棍PS的压缩与转码功能,让您能够自由压缩图片尺寸,适应不同平台的分享需求。

操作步骤:

  1. 选择“压缩转码”功能。
  2. 从相册中选择需要压缩或转换格式的图片。
  3. 设置压缩比例或选择需要转换的格式(如JPEG、PNG等),并点击“开始压缩”。
  4. 完成后,您可以预览压缩后的图片质量,并选择保存。

小提示: 尽量选择合适的压缩比例,既能减小文件大小,又能保持足够的画质。


3. 照片放大与缩小:调整尺寸,满足个性需求

无论是放大照片中的细节,还是缩小图片适应不同平台,火棍PS的放大缩小功能都能快速完成。放大功能尤其适合需要打印照片的用户,保证图像在较大尺寸下仍保持清晰。

操作步骤:

  1. 打开“照片放大/缩小”功能。
  2. 选择需要调整尺寸的照片。
  3. 输入所需的尺寸或选择自动放大/缩小选项。
  4. 您可以实时预览调整后的效果,确认满意后点击“保存”。

小提示: 放大照片时,建议使用火棍PS的“智能增强”功能,以保证放大后的清晰度。


4. 一键抠图:轻松分离主体,创建个性合成

火棍PS的一键抠图功能,特别适合制作个性化的照片合成。无论是把自己置身在异国风景中,还是在创意拼图中添加独特元素,抠图功能都能实现。

操作步骤:

  1. 选择“一键抠图”功能。
  2. 选择一张需要抠图的照片,App会自动识别照片中的主体。
  3. 自动抠图完成后,您可以手动微调边缘,确保抠图效果自然流畅。
  4. 抠图完成后,可以为图片选择一个新的背景或保存抠出的人物主体。

小提示: 您还可以添加滤镜或特效,增强抠图后的效果。


5. 拼图功能:多张照片轻松组合,分享多样精彩

拼图功能让您可以将多张照片拼接在一起,记录旅行中的每一站,或者制作属于自己的精美拼图作品。火棍PS的拼图模板丰富,让您能选择不同的风格和布局。

操作步骤:

  1. 选择“拼图”功能。
  2. 从相册中选择要拼接的照片,最多可选择9张。
  3. 选择您喜欢的拼图布局,如网格、拼接、自由排布等。
  4. 在布局内可以调整照片的位置、大小和旋转角度,并添加背景颜色或花纹。
  5. 完成后,可以为整个拼图添加滤镜,增加照片的整体美感。

小提示: 不妨尝试不同的布局和配色,让拼图更具创意和个性。


进阶小技巧

  1. 自动对焦与清晰度增强:在调整尺寸或压缩图片时,火棍PS提供了智能自动对焦和清晰度增强工具,帮助您确保照片在调整后的效果依然完美。
  2. 添加滤镜和特效:在拼图或抠图后,不妨试用滤镜或特效,为您的作品增添专业感。
  3. 照片美化模式:火棍PS的美化工具可以调节光影、色彩等,让您的照片看起来更加生动。

总结

火棍PS是一款极为实用的图片编辑App,不仅操作简单,还能提供丰富多样的照片编辑功能,帮助您轻松处理照片中的各种问题。老照片修复、图片压缩转码、尺寸调整、一键抠图和拼图等功能覆盖了日常图片处理的几乎所有需求,让每一张照片都能焕发新生。

无论您是想要复原旧日回忆,还是希望创作出具有独特风格的作品,火棍PS都能为您提供便捷的解决方案。现在就下载并使用火棍PS,体验照片编辑的乐趣,开启您的创作之旅!

<think>好的,我现在需要帮助用户解决关于使用Photoshop或类似工具生成老旧照片修复的代码或方法的问题。用户提到的是代码实现方法,可能是指自动化脚本或者图像处理算法。首先,我得确认用户的需求:他们可能想了解如何通过编程或脚本在Photoshop中自动修复老照片,或者希望了解图像处理的具体算法,以便在其他工具中实现类似功能。 接下来,我需要参考提供的引用内容。引用1和2提到Photoshop的手动修复方法,比如修复画笔、仿制图章等工具,以及色彩调整步骤。引用3和4提到了一些AI工具和Stable Diffusion结合Photoshop的方法。但用户的问题更偏向于代码实现,这可能涉及Photoshop的脚本功能或图像处理库的使用。 首先,Photoshop本身支持JavaScript、AppleScript和VBScript脚本,用户可以通过编写脚本自动化一些修复步骤。例如,自动应用滤镜、调整色阶或曲线等。此外,使用Python结合Pillow或OpenCV库也可以实现类似的图像处理算法,比如降噪、锐化、色彩校正等。 然后,考虑到用户可能不熟悉编程,需要分步骤解释。例如,使用Photoshop脚本的基本步骤,或者用Python代码实现特定修复功能的示例。同时,引用中提到的AI工具如牛学长和火棍PS可能使用了深度学习模型,这部分可能需要使用TensorFlow或PyTorch框架,但对于普通用户来说可能比较复杂,所以可能需要简要提及。 另外,需要确保回答结构清晰,步骤详细,并生成相关问题。同时,按照用户的要求,所有数学表达式用$...$格式,如卷积公式$G(x,y) = \frac{1}{2\pi\sigma^2}e^{-\frac{x^2+y^2}{2\sigma^2}}$。 最后,验证信息是否正确,比如Photoshop脚本的扩展名是.jsx,Python库的正确使用方式,以及算法步骤是否合理。需要确保引用相关的引用内容,比如Photoshop的手动步骤来自引用2,AI方法来自引用4。</think>### Photoshop老旧照片修复的代码实现方法 #### 一、基于Photoshop脚本的自动化修复 Photoshop支持通过JavaScript脚本实现自动化操作(.jsx文件扩展名)[^2]。以下是修复流程的脚本化实现思路: 1. **基础修复脚本示例** ```javascript // 自动色阶调整 var adjustLevels = function() { var desc = new ActionDescriptor(); desc.putEnumerated( charIDToTypeID("Lvls"), charIDToTypeID("Lvls"), charIDToTypeID("Adjs") ); executeAction( charIDToTypeID("Lvls"), desc, DialogModes.NO ); }; // 运行脚本 adjustLevels(); ``` 2. **核心算法对应关系** - 降噪处理:对应中值滤波算法,数学表达式为: $$ I'(x,y) = \text{median}\{I(x+i,y+j) | (i,j) \in W\} $$ 其中$W$表示滤波窗口 - 锐化处理:使用拉普拉斯算子卷积核: $$ \nabla^2 I = \frac{\partial^2 I}{\partial x^2} + \frac{\partial^2 I}{\partial y^2} $$ #### 二、Python图像处理实现 使用Pillow和OpenCV库实现核心算法: ```python import cv2 import numpy as np from PIL import Image, ImageFilter def old_photo_restoration(path): # 读取图像 img = cv2.imread(path) # 降噪处理(非局部均值去噪) denoised = cv2.fastNlMeansDenoisingColored(img, None, 10,10,7,21) # 色彩校正(直方图均衡化) lab = cv2.cvtColor(denoised, cv2.COLOR_BGR2LAB) l,a,b = cv2.split(lab) clahe = cv2.createCLAHE(clipLimit=3.0, tileGridSize=(8,8)) l = clahe.apply(l) merged = cv2.merge((l,a,b)) # 锐化处理(Unsharp Mask) pil_img = Image.fromarray(cv2.cvtColor(merged, cv2.COLOR_BGR2RGB)) sharpened = pil_img.filter(ImageFilter.UnsharpMask( radius=2, percent=150, threshold=3 )) return sharpened ``` #### 三、深度学习方法 结合引用[4]中提到的Stable Diffusion技术,可实现AI修复: ```python from diffusers import StableDiffusionInpaintPipeline import torch model = StableDiffusionInpaintPipeline.from_pretrained( "stabilityai/stable-diffusion-2-inpainting", torch_dtype=torch.float16, ).to("cuda") # 生成修复遮罩(需配合图像分割算法) mask = generate_mask(damaged_image) # 执行修复 restored_image = model( prompt="old photo restoration, high detail", image=damaged_image, mask_image=mask ).images[0] ```
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值